Why the “No Wagering” Part Changes Everything

Most bonuses are traps. You get 100 spins, but you have to wager the winnings 40x or 50x before you see a penny. That is a grind. When you see a deposit 1 get 100 free spins 2026 uk no wagering offer, the math flips in your favour. Every penny you win from those spins is yours. No hidden rollover. No maximum win cap (well, some have a small cap, but it’s usually fair). From what I’ve seen, this is the only type of bonus that actually respects your time as a player.

Now, not every site runs this exact deal. Some slap on a 1x wagering requirement, which is basically nothing. Others give you the spins instantly. The key is finding the ones that honour the “no wagering” promise without fine-print tricks.

How to Claim a £1 Deposit Bonus Without Getting Burned

Here is a quick, no-nonsense guide. If you want to grab a deposit 1 get 100 free spins 2026 uk no wagering deal, follow these steps:

  1. Check the UKGC licence. Only play at casinos regulated by the UK Gambling Commission. It’s the only way to guarantee fair play and your funds are safe.
  2. Read the wagering terms. Even if the spins are “no wagering,” check if the deposit itself has a requirement. Some casinos want you to wager the £1 deposit 1x before you can withdraw. That’s fine. 40x is not.
  3. Look at the max win cap. A no-wagering spin deal might cap your winnings at £50 or £100. That’s still free money. Just know the ceiling.
  4. Use a promo code if needed. Some offers require a code like BONUS2026 or SPINMAX. Enter it during deposit.
  5. Play on the specified slot. The free spins are usually locked to one game (e.g., Starburst, Book of Dead). Don’t try to use them on another slot. It won’t work.
  6. Withdraw immediately. Once you’ve played the spins, your winnings should be in your cash balance. Withdraw them straight away. Don’t gamble them unless you want to.

Common Misconceptions About No-Wagering Free Spins

I hear a lot of nonsense about these deals. Let me clear a few things up.

Myth: “No wagering means I can withdraw the spin winnings instantly.”
Truth: Yes, that’s exactly what it means. The winnings from the free spins are cash. No playthrough. You can withdraw them right after the spins finish. Some casinos might ask for ID verification first, but that’s standard.

Myth: “These offers are only for new players.”
Truth: Most are for new players only. But some casinos, like PlayOJO and Casumo, run similar no-wagering spin deals for existing players too. It’s worth checking your inbox.

Myth: “The slots are rigged when you use free spins.”
Truth: No. UKGC-licensed casinos use certified RNGs. The free spins run on the same RTP as real money spins. You have the same chance of hitting a win.

Responsible Gambling and Player Safety

All operators listed here are licensed by the UK Gambling Commission and promote responsible gambling tools. You can set deposit limits, take time-outs, or self-exclude via GAMSTOP. The GamCare helpline is available at 0808 8020 133, and Samaritans can be reached at 116 123. We strongly recommend using these resources if you feel your play is becoming problematic.
